Hi guys. Last night my anenmome was really wide and I thought wow he's extra big today and this afternoon I came home and there is two anemones in my tank next to each other? Two mouths and all. Should I be freaking out? Ohh btw the top one is A little shrunk that's cause Im in the middle of feeding. They split when they are happy. I started with one green bubble tip anemone. Now I have about 20
 
Well if you feed them a ton they can split due to that as well but usually it is stress.
 
I do target feed mine once a week but I bring the split ones to my LFS and get credit for them!
 
Mixed information everywhere lol. Many say that's them spawning many say they're about to die but my onion is they split a little more than a week ago and they're both thriving and growing more
 
The jury is still out. I personally dont think they split because they are happy. I believe that when stressed they will split. But like I said nobody really knows and I see both opinions pretty often.
 
It's been a while since he split and they're both happy champs! Water is perfect and the ecosys is thriving! I'm takin it as a good thing
 
They can reproduce by splitting, but it's mostly due to stress. Especially in closed systems. Those anemones look quite bleached.
